The Evolution of Private Credit

Private credit emerged following the Global Financial Crisis as banks retreated from corporate lending, creating a structural funding gap.

Since then, it has evolved through three distinct phases:

  • Middle-market lending (2010-2016)
  • Institutionalisation (2016-2021)
  • Mass market expansion (2021-present)

Today, it represents a significant and growing part of the global credit ecosystem, with increasing scale, participation and complexity.
